The Australia Stakes is a Group 2 sprint held at Moonee Valley Racecourse (Pakenham in 2026) in late January as a lead-up to the Group 1 races run over the Melbourne Autumn Racing Carnival.



The 2026 Australia Stakes is a Group 2 race held each year in late January in Victoria. Previously held at Moonee Valley Racecourse in Melbourne, in 2026 the event will take place at Pakenham. Run over 1200m under weight-for-age conditions, this sprint race is worth $350,000 in prize money.

Hedged ($9.50) produced a powerhouse performance to take out the 2026 Australia Stakes results at Pakenham on Friday night, stamping himself as a genuine star on the rise with his track record winning performance. The talented Gavin Bedggood trained sprinter travelled beautifully throughout before unleashing a sharp turn of foot in the straight, putting the race to bed with authority against a seasoned field after running down the hot favourite War Machine who held for third. A polished ride from Harry Coffey and a perfectly timed move sealed the deal, and Hedged walked away with one of the most impressive victories of the summer sprinting ranks.

It is one of only a couple of Group 2 races held in January anywhere in the country and signals the return of regular black type racing to Melbourne.

The Australia Stakes serves as a nice campaign kick-off for sprinters heading towards tougher races during the Melbourne Autumn Racing Carnival.

It is a key lead-up race into the Group 1 C.F. Orr Stakes (1400m) run at Caulfield in February and Black Caviar (2012) followed by Streets Of Avalon (2021) are the last runners to do the double.

In 2022 the Australia Stakes winner Marabi franked the form winning the Group 1 Oakleigh Plate (1100m) at Caulfield on Blue Diamond Stakes Day next start.

The 2024 Australia Stakes form was franked with the winner, Veight, running fourth next-up in the C.F. Orr before a Group 1 Australian Guineas second and victory in Sydney’s Group 1 George Ryder Stakes. The form was further franked with the runner-up, Southport Tycoon, winning the Australian Guineas over the Flemington mile when turning the tables on Veight.

The 2025 Australia Stakes winner Schwarz franked the form that autumn winning the Group 1 William Reid Stakes back at Moonee Valley.

The Australia Stakes 2026 ran at Southside Pakenham on Friday January 23, 2026 with a redevelopment taking place at the event’s traditional home at The Valley and was won ina big late charge by the Gavin Bedggood trained Hedged ($9.50).

Australia Stakes History

Formerly called the Carlyon Stakes until 2010, the Moonee Valley Racing Club changed the race name to the Australia Stakes to celebrate Australia Day.

This race is not to be confused with the Group 1 William Reid Stakes, which was previously called the Australia Stakes, and is now once again called the William Reid Stakes and runs in March.

Originally a Listed race and known as the Carlyon Stakes, this race earned Group 3 status in 1990 until 1994 when it was again elevated to Group 2 status.

The Australia Stakes has been won by plenty of outstanding horses over the years including recent champions such as Black Caviar (2010 & 2012) and Malaguerra (2017).

With Moonee Valley under redevelopment in 2026, the event that year runs at Southside Pakenham.

In 2026 Hedged won the Australia Stakes to set a new Pakenham track record saluting in 1:07.58.
